    FEBRUARY FAT QUARTER SWAP – Reds, Pinks & Whites

    FAT QUARTERS MEASURE 18” x 22”.


    Each pair of swap partners is swapping ONE SET OF FIVE FQ’s. You may sign up for more than one swap partner if you like. ((However, you may not necessarily be paired up with more than one)).

    Send me a PM to sign up including your board name real name, address and a phone number where I can reach you in case your package is not sent/received. Please PM me when you send and when you have received your FQ's. Tracking ###s are nice but optional. Per board rules if you do not follow the swap rules you risk being banned from future swaps.

    PLEASE COMMUNICATE WITH YOUR SWAP PARTNER WHEN YOU HAVE RECEIVED YOUR FQ’S.

    MAILING DEADLINE IS February 10[SUP]th[/SUP]. THIS IS ETCHED IN STONE.

    Sign-ups are open until February 3[SUP]rd[/SUP] and names will be posted on the 5[SUP]th[/SUP].
